Understanding the Needs of Tall Individuals
The average office chair just isn't designed with extra height in mind. Features like seat depth, backrest height, and lumbar support often fall short for those over 6 feet tall. A chair too shallow forces you to sit awkwardly, hunching forward or slouching to compensate. Inadequate backrest height leaves your upper back unsupported, leading to discomfort and potential long-term problems. And a lumbar support that's positioned too low is, well, useless.
Seat Depth: The Unsung Hero
Seat depth is crucial. A chair with insufficient seat depth means your knees are bent at an uncomfortable angle, while too much depth leaves you unsupported at the back. You need a chair with adjustable depth, allowing you to customize it for your precise proportions.
Backrest Height: Reaching New Heights
Finding a chair with adequate backrest height is critical for supporting your entire back. Look for a chair whose backrest extends beyond your shoulder blades to provide comprehensive support. An adjustable backrest is even better, allowing you to tailor the support precisely.
Lumbar Support: The King of Comfort
Lumbar support is paramount. It provides crucial support for the lower back, preventing slouching and promoting proper posture. A chair's lumbar support should be adjustable and positioned to align perfectly with your natural lumbar curve.
Beyond the Basics: Armrests and Adjustability
Armrests play a supporting role. Adjustable armrests, specifically, allow you to position your arms comfortably, reducing strain on your shoulders and neck. Full adjustability, including height, width, and depth, is the gold standard. Don't forget the overall chair height; your feet should be flat on the floor when seated.

Herman Miller Aeron: The Classic Choice
The Herman Miller Aeron is legendary for a reason. Its innovative design features a PostureFit SL support system that adjusts to your back's natural curve, offering exceptional lumbar support. The fully adjustable seat depth and height accommodate a wide range of body sizes, making it a solid option for tall individuals. Its breathable mesh material keeps you cool and comfortable even during long hours of sitting. While on the higher end price-wise, the Aeron’s reputation for durability and comfort makes it a worthwhile investment for many.
Pros and Cons of the Aeron
- Pros: Exceptional comfort, durability, adjustability, breathable material.
- Cons: High price point, can be a bit stiff for some users.
Steelcase Leap: Ergonomic Excellence
The Steelcase Leap is another high-end option known for its ergonomic design. Similar to the Aeron, it features extensive adjustability to accommodate different body types and preferences. The Leap's back support is especially effective, conforming to the natural curves of the spine. Its robust construction ensures long-term durability.
Pros and Cons of the Steelcase Leap
- Pros: Outstanding ergonomic design, excellent back support, durable construction.
- Cons: High price point, the learning curve to master all the adjustments.
Autonomous ErgoChair 2: A Budget-Friendly Contender
For those seeking a more budget-friendly option, the Autonomous ErgoChair 2 is a strong contender. While not as feature-rich as the Aeron or Leap, it offers a respectable level of adjustability, including height, seat depth, and lumbar support. Its breathable mesh back helps to keep you cool, and its overall design provides comfortable seating for extended periods.
Pros and Cons of the Autonomous ErgoChair 2
- Pros: Affordable price point, good adjustability, comfortable for extended use.
- Cons: May not be as durable as higher-end options, fewer adjustment options compared to premium chairs.

Q: How can I determine the correct seat depth and backrest height for my needs?
A: The ideal seat depth allows you to sit with your knees bent at a 90-degree angle, with your thighs fully supported. The backrest height should extend past your shoulder blades, providing complete support for your entire back. These measurements will vary based on individual height and proportions. Trying out chairs before purchasing, if possible, is highly recommended.
Q: What if I can't find a chair that perfectly fits my needs?
A: It's rare to find a perfectly fitting chair off the shelf. Consider using additional lumbar support cushions or seat cushions to bridge any gaps and enhance comfort. Look for chairs with a wide range of adjustability to allow you to fine-tune the fit as closely as possible to your specific requirements. Custom-made chairs are also a possibility but usually involve a significantly higher price tag.
Q: How often should I replace my desk chair?
A: There's no magic number, but if your chair begins to show significant wear and tear (like broken parts or significant sagging), it's time for a replacement. Also consider replacement if your chair no longer adequately supports your posture or causes persistent discomfort, regardless of its age. Prolonged use of an inadequate chair can lead to long-term back problems.
